JOB PURPOSE
The Factory Leader is responsible for operating a factory as per agreed standards. S/he leads manufacturing activities in the factory to achieve desired service levels on time. The Factory Leader delivers site targets following the supply chain and category strategies including targets on service, costs, productivity, quality, innovation and OSHE.
WHAT WILL YOUR MAIN RESPONSIBILITIES BE
- Deploy and deliver annual plan and financial results including targets on service, costs, productivity, quality, innovation and OSHE
- Develop long term site strategic plans to the Regional Category and Supply Chain teams
- Lead site to develop and implement continuous improvement plans to deliver site targets –manufacturing performance management
- Manage and deliver the site’s financial results: annual budgets, sourcing Unit result, conversion costs and create programmes to deliver financial results
- Engage and facilitate the implementation of innovations on site, for products, ways of working, service models and supply chain models
- Propose, agree with Category Technology and implement the necessary capital investments to meet the planned production requirements, safety, environmental and cost targets
- Pursue a site long term plan, including restructuring, re-engineering and retrofitting as agreed by VP SC Category; prioritize and plan resources development and deployment
- Ensure that the technical standards of all manufacturing and non-manufacturing fixed assets are maintained.
- Enable the factory operation to achieve high level of Customer Service at optimal cost
- Support Unilever Manufacturing System (UMS) activities and teams by leading the UMS Steering Committee
- Co-ordinate and direct the factory and co-packer operations to achieve the agreed production plans at the specified product quality with optimum labour, energy and materials utilization.
- Ensure Working Capital management systems are effectively used, and deliver inventory targets set with Regional Category Planning Directors and Regional Supply Management Directors.
- Co-ordinate and direct the quality management in line with QA system and ISO 9000 procedures.
- Lead HR policy deployment and implementation on sites, including management of employee relations.
- Ensure effective local stakeholder management and community issues aligned with Unilever policies.
- Guard and ensure the application of all Unilever Policies and governance requirements.
- Lead on initiatives and projects aiming for sites integration and collaborative work along the extended supply chain.
- Lead Supply Planning
- Be the statutory head of factory where there is a legal separation
